About Katja Petzold

Katja Petzold is a scholar working on Virology, Molecular Biology and Nephrology, having authored 49 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(18 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(14 papers) and RNA modifications and cancer (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nephrology (265 citations), Virology (78 citations) and Molecular Biology (976 citations). Katja Petzold has collaborated with scholars based in Sweden,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Hashim M. Al‐Hashimi, Judith Schlagnitweit, Jürgen Schleucher, Bharathwaj Sathyamoorthy, Isaac J. Kimsey, Maja Marušič, Jeetender Chugh, Elizabeth A. Dethoff, Andreas L. Serra and Anette Casiano‐Negroni. Their work appears in journals such as Nature, Journal of the American Chemical Society and Nucleic Acids Research.
